** The Subaru repair market serving Oriskany Falls is characterized by a need to travel to neighboring commercial centers. The quality of service available is quite high, with a clear tiered structure: * **Dealer Level (Fuccillo Subaru):** Offers the highest assurance for complex, technology-driven systems (EyeSight, Hybrid, CVT) but at a premium price point. Labor rates are typically the highest in the market. * **Specialist Independent Shops (Garlough's, North Star):** Provide exceptional value for mechanical repairs (engines, transmissions, turbos) often at 20-30% lower labor rates than the dealer. Their strength lies in experienced, nuanced problem-solving for issues common to the Subaru brand. * **General Repair Shops:** While abundant, most lack the specific tooling (e.g., for AWD dynos or EyeSight calibration) and deep brand-specific experience for the specialized services requested. They are suitable for basic maintenance but a higher risk for complex diagnostics. Competition is healthy among the top-tier independents, driving a focus on customer service and quality. Pricing for a common repair like a head gasket replacement on a non-turbo Subaru engine typically ranges from $2,500 to $3,800 in this market, depending on the shop and whether additional components are replaced proactively. For Oriskany Falls residents, the short commute to Utica or Clinton is a necessary step to access this level of specialized automotive care.

Due to our rural roads and harsh winter climate, common issues include premature wear on suspension components like control arms and struts, as well as CV joint and axle wear from potholes and rough terrain. Subaru-specific issues like head gasket leaks on older models (pre-2012) and wheel bearing failures are also prevalent and should be monitored.

You should have the AWD system checked if you notice unusual noises during turns, vibrations, or a dashboard warning light (like the AT TEMP or Check Engine light). Given our steep hills and heavy snow, proactive maintenance of the differentials and transmission fluid is crucial for safe winter driving on routes like Route 12B.
Labor rates in Oriskany Falls are often more competitive than in major metro areas like Syracuse or Utica, potentially lowering overall cost. However, parts availability can sometimes cause minor delays, so choosing a shop with a reliable parts network is key to avoiding extended downtime.
The combination of road salt in winter and gravel/dirt back roads in summer means you should adhere strictly to severe service intervals. This includes more frequent undercarriage washes to combat rust, and more frequent inspections of brakes, suspension, and fluid changes to handle the demanding terrain around the Oriskany Creek area.
